If you cannot get RDP to work on your LAN by accessing the workstation's local IP, then the problem likely with the workstation or the client, not the Orbi. Get it working on the LAN first, then try port forwarding.
Check Windows Firewall on the workstation. Turn the firewall OFF and see if RDP works. Did you change the subnet you are using on your LAN when you switched to Orbi? If so, maybe the firewall was setup to allow the old subnet.
- Mikey94025Jan 31, 2017HeroYou created a new Wireless network when you setup your Orbi. It's likely blocking RDP. If you right-click the wireless taskbar icon and Open Network and Sharing Center, does it say "private network" or "public network"? I believe that public defaults to blocking RDP.
